The installer doesn't have a way of knowing this either, and libdialog does
not provide a dropdown widget. The obvious choices (freebsd-ufs, etc.) are
displayed in the help line at the bottom of the screen and change depending
on what the current scheme is (e.g. freebsd vs. freebsd-ufs). Can you think
of a clearer way to communicate the possibilities?
